Output 50ae80cfb706158e88cbdf60436db4a147027c0352310bfc6888a55eacc04317:0

value
15000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bc8e93c5c6599e4a05f9edb847b4c37dfcb6170 OP_EQUAL
address
3FtjLpjfsewkqeta2icc6urEugGc94cse4
transaction
50ae80cfb706158e88cbdf60436db4a147027c0352310bfc6888a55eacc04317
spent
true